Travelling from Sidcup to Arlesey by Train

Embark on a train journey from Sidcup to Arlesey, and you'll find it's quicker than you might anticipate!

The typical travel time is about 1hrs 49 mins, but if you're in a hurry or just eager to arrive, the fastest trains can whisk you there in just 1hrs 30 mins. With approximately 38 trains running daily, you have a wealth of options to choose from. This scenic route, spanning 43 miles (70 km), generally involves just one transfer, and operators like Thameslink, Southeastern offer comfortable seating with plenty of room for your luggage.

Here's the best part: by booking your tickets in advance, you can snag fares starting from only £30.60, offering a substantial saving over buying tickets at the last minute. For even more savings, consider traveling during Off-Peak times or using a Railcard.

What are my cheap ticket options for Sidcup to Arlesey journ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sidcup to Arlesey are available for £30.60 one way, or £36.30 return

Facilities & Accessibility at Sidcup Station

At Sidcup Station, passenger convenience takes center stage. The ticket office is operational every day, offering a broad window from early morning till late evening. For those who prefer the speed of self-service, there are multiple ticket vending machines located conveniently on both platforms. So, whether you're a planner who gets tickets in advance or a spur-of-the-moment traveler, your needs are covered.

Accessibility is critically managed here, ensuring that step-free access is available through dedicated entrances for both directions. Sidcup Station falls under Category B, catering to limited yet essential accessibility needs. While some platforms feature footbridge interchange, the station thoughtfully provides step-free interfaces via roadways, making it feasible for differently-abled passengers and those with heavy luggage.

Onward Travel Made Easy

Sidcup Station seamlessly connects you to various onward travel options, easing the transition between different modes of transportation. From the bustling station, you are within easy reach of local bus services and a nearby taxi office, conveniently located on the approach road to the car park. Should your train service be temporarily disrupted, rest easy knowing that the rail replacement services are easily accessible from the main entrance on Jubilee Way. Facilities and Amenities

The station is equipped with essential am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. Ticket purchasing is convenient with a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day, although there's no service on Sundays. Ticket machines are accessible, supporting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, making Arlesey station an inclusive option for all travelers.

For assistance, there are help points located on the platforms, with staff available during select hours on weekdays and Saturdays. Traveller safety is a priority with CCTV surveillance throughout the station. Although Arlesey lacks traditional waiting rooms, there are seating areas available to passengers.

Accessibility is a focus at Arlesey, with step-free access to platforms, albeit through separate entrances. For those requiring additional assistance, ramps are available, and staff assistance can be arranged through various convenient contact methods. Be mindful though, as there aren't any tactile surfaces on the platforms.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

Convenient transport links make Arlesey an ideal station for onward travel. Bus services connect the station with surrounding locales, with information readily available to help plan your journey. While there isn't a taxi rank directly at the station, local taxi services are available to make transit to your final destination smooth.

Cycling and Parking

For the eco-conscious traveler or the cycling enthusiast, Arlesey provides a well-maintained space for bicycles, with plenty of racks monitored continuously by CCTV. Additionally, parking is ample with over 100 spaces, operating around the clock, and the cherry on top— it's free of charge!
